Hope Botanical Gardens
Located in Saint Andrew, this site is a botanical garden covering approximately 81 hectares. Visitors go here to walk through diverse plant collections and observe local nature in a quiet environment away from the urban density of Kingston.
Getting There
The gardens are situated a short distance from the center of Kingston. Most travelers use taxis or ride-sharing services to reach the site. Depending on traffic conditions, the journey typically takes 15 to 30 minutes from the downtown area.
Duration of Visit
Because of the large size of the grounds, allow 2 to 4 hours to walk the main paths and view the various plant species at a relaxed pace.
When to Visit
Morning visits are recommended to avoid the peak midday heat of Jamaica. The gardens can become crowded on weekends and public holidays when local residents visit for recreation. The weather remains tropical year-round, though the drier season is generally more comfortable for walking.
Combining with Other Attractions
The location allows for easy combination with other nearby sites in Kingston:
- Mona (1km): Very close for a quick transition.
- Bob Marley Museum (3.2km): A short drive to one of the city's primary cultural sites.
- New Kingston (4km): Convenient for those needing access to business districts or dining.
- Emancipation Park (4.8km): Another open green space located within a few kilometers' radius.
